    I figured out what the issue was. When I was cleaning up and changing some admin accounts I deleted mine (I had a backup) but it was assigned the keymaster role. So I removed the only keymaster there was and therefore I didn’t have the appropriate access to receive it on my dashboard.

    I was advised to install the bbpack plugin and from there I was able to give myself keymaster access. Problem solved.

    Note: have more than one keymaster to help with this issue.
